John Lewis & Partners

John Lewis & Partners, an online shopping website in the UK is a top retail website in terms of quality and customer service. The company also offers many other items including electronics, furniture, flowers, and books. John Lewis offers a wide selection of clothes and accessories for women, men, and children. Customers can browse the latest trends in fashion and discover the newest offers and discounts.

John Lewis' profits are shared with its employees, who are referred to as partners. This co-ownership arrangement gives employees a stake in the company and is seen as a blueprint for a more humane and sustainable capitalism. In addition to the annual bonus, partners get 25 percent off John Lewis and Waitrose goods as well as half-price theatre, tickets for sports and concerts and subsidized training and leisure courses. They also enjoy job security levels that are above the average for their field.
